    Range Rover GT Expands Luxury Lineup With Electric Power

    Range Rover introduces the new Range Rover GT, an all-electric grand tourer built on the advanced EMA platform, blending luxury, performance, and aerodynamic design.

    Range Rover has officially announced the expansion of its product family with the addition of the new Range Rover GT. Representing the brand’s fifth model line, this vehicle blends the sophisticated aesthetic of a grand tourer with the renowned utility and off-road heritage of the iconic SUV lineup. Developed as the first model to utilize the advanced EMA platform, the Range Rover GT is launching initially as a fully electric vehicle. The manufacturer confirms that this new series will exist alongside the existing portfolio rather than replacing the current Velar, marking a significant strategic evolution in the brand’s design and engineering trajectory.

    • The Range Rover GT debuts as the first vehicle built on the JLR-developed EMA architecture.
    • The model will launch with an all-electric powertrain with future plans for hybrid integration.
    • Production for the new vehicle is scheduled to take place at the Halewood facility in the United Kingdom.
    • The interior design prioritizes a minimalist approach by eliminating physical buttons in favor of integrated touchscreen controls.

    Aerodynamic Design Enhances Electric Range

    The design of the Range Rover GT signals a departure from traditional boxy SUV silhouettes, leaning toward a more aerodynamic and car-like stance. Its length rivals the Range Rover Sport, yet the vehicle features an intentionally lowered nose and a sleek, sloping roofline.

    This aerodynamic profile serves a dual purpose by significantly increasing the electric driving range while minimizing cabin noise to provide the quietest experience in the brand’s history.

    While the reduced ride height necessitates some compromises regarding extreme rock-crawling capabilities, the vehicle remains engineered for light off-road terrain. Testing phases are currently in the final stages, with prototypes enduring extreme temperatures ranging from minus 40 to 50 degrees Celsius to ensure robust global performance. The vehicle will launch exclusively with a dual-motor, all-wheel-drive configuration.

    Interior Aesthetics Prioritize Modern Technology

    The cabin of the Range Rover GT embraces a philosophy of reductionism, stripping away unnecessary visual clutter. The driver-focused cockpit features a high-mounted instrument cluster paired with a wide, horizontally aligned central touchscreen.

    Innovative design choices include hiding ventilation outlets within the dashboard structure and concealing speakers beneath woven fabric surfaces. Leather alternatives are set to be standard, reflecting a commitment to modern material science. To streamline the user experience, gear selection has been moved to the steering column, and climate controls are fully integrated into the digital interface.

    The rear of the vehicle is designed to provide a premium environment, initially offering two independent seats with a fixed center console, though a traditional three-person bench remains under consideration. Despite the aggressive roofline, the EMA platform’s battery layout allows for impressive legroom that rivals the larger flagship models.
